I've been looking at dwc2 for a while and I think this is a bug in
dwc2_hsotg_irq() on the branch for GINTSTS_USBRST. I don't have docs for
dwc2.
Nowhere in that function is driver making sure DCFG_DEVADDR is cleared
to 0. In fact, there nowhere at all in the driver where you're making
sure to reset device address:
$ git --no-pager grep --color -nH -e DCFG_DEVADDR_ -- drivers/usb/dwc2/
drivers/usb/dwc2/gadget.c:1837: dcfg &= ~DCFG_DEVADDR_MASK;
drivers/usb/dwc2/gadget.c:1839: DCFG_DEVADDR_SHIFT) &
DCFG_DEVADDR_MASK;
drivers/usb/dwc2/hw.h:426:#define DCFG_DEVADDR_MASK (0x7f << 4)
drivers/usb/dwc2/hw.h:427:#define DCFG_DEVADDR_SHIFT 4
drivers/usb/dwc2/hw.h:428:#define DCFG_DEVADDR_LIMIT 0x7f
If we look into gadget.c on those lines, here's what we have:

So you only touch DEVADDR from SetAddress. That's clearly a bug
elsewhere in the driver and is *NOT* related to USB CV at all. Please
fix this driver properly instead of hacking around unrelated functions.
Disconnect IRQ is *NOT* supposed to clear device address. That's a job
for Reset IRQ.
